Europeans imported or wove imitations of the luxurious silks, camlets, and brocades of the East. The traditional Turkish aesthetic of layered front-opening coats and jackets with buttons had migrated into European costume through commerce and diplomacy and, later, illustrated travel books, starting late in the fourteenth century. But till the late eighteenth century not even European males wore what we might consider trousers. Their decrease clothes consisted principally of leg-displaying hose and brief breeches in varied mixtures. A costume design by Léon Bakst for a Ballets Russes 1910 manufacturing ofScheherazade, the picture incorporates a Turkish type of trousers that proved influential overseas in addition to exotic parts typical of the Western fantasy of what harem life was like. Tracing the centrality of women in the definition of Turkish secularism, this study investigates the 2003 decision to extend the number of ladies officers employed by the Presidency of Religious Affairs . It explores how, as professional non secular officers, the female Diyanet preachers epitomize a pious, fashionable and extremely educated girl whose position in society has been raised to prominence. Based on in depth fieldwork in Turkey, and drawing on a wealthy ethnography of the activities conducted by Diyanet girls preachers in Istanbul, Chiara Maritato disentangles the state’s attempt to standardize a multifaceted feminine religious participation.

Born in 1915, Azra Erhat was an creator, archaeologist, classical philologist and translator of the classical literature of Ancient Greece, similar to Homer’s “Iliad” and “Odyssey” into Turkish. Her work singlehandedly launched the nation to the epic tales and heroes of antiquity from the very same lands and led to the foundation of social sciences in Turkey. Visitors to the nation ought to thank her for coining the time period “Blue Voyage” in the title of a e-book she wrote of the expertise.
